The ingredients needed to prepare Acorn Squash Soup & Toasted Seeds:
  1. Get 2 acorn squash (skin on)
  2. Provide 1 yellow onion
  3. Prepare 2 cloves garlic
  4. Take 2 tbsp salt
  5. Take 2 tbsp pepper
  6. Get Dash cayenne pepper
  7. Prepare 1 tsp thyme
  8. Provide 1 tsp cinnamon
  9. Take 1 tbsp honey
  10. Get 16 oz chicken stock (use vegetable stock for vegan)
  11. Use 16 oz water
  12. You need 1 pint heavy whipping cream (leave out for vegan)
Steps to make Acorn Squash Soup & Toasted Seeds:
  1. Chop onion into large chunks and smash garlic cloves and sauté for a few minutes until aromatic. Add salt, pepper and chunks of acorn squash and cook on medium heat for a few minutes.
  2. Add chicken stock and water and simmer for about 10 minutes.
  3. Blend mixture with immersion blender and add in thyme and honey. Add more seasoning if desired.
  4. Add whipping cream and serve hot!
  5. For toasted acorn squash seeds, clean seeds and dry first. Mix olive oil, a dash or salt and pepper and evenly coat seeds. Bake on 325 for 20 minutes! Serve on top of soup or as a snack for another day.
